...."While unpleasant, the incident is a long way from the worst to have happened in the air. Apart from drunken fighting and brawling, the world record for airborne grossness, if there is such a thing, was set in 1996 by New York investment banker Gerard Finneran.

Finneran screamed obscenities and yelled repeatedly for more alcohol while flying first class on United Airlines from Buenos Aires to New York. Finally, after threatening a flight attendant with violence when no alcohol arrived, Finneran demonstrated his displeasure by leaping from his seat and defecating on a first-class food trolley.

He was fined USD50,000."
